Abstract

The utility model discloses a coal-fired smoke-eliminating vertical boiler which improves original vertical boiler. Grate bars which are at the middle of the grate are in linear parallel arrangement and the around grate bars are in concentric circles arrangement, and a heat-storing device is arranged at a top of a furnace, and a wind-sending device which is divided into two to five-layers is arranged inside the furnace, and a cylinder shape wind-resisting device is arranged under the grate bars of the grate which are in linear parallel arrangement. The utility model has the advantages of compact structure, full coal combustion, saving energy, convenient maintenance, good smoke-eliminating and dusting effect and according with the national environmental protection requirements, etc.

Description

Coal-fired smoke elimination vertical boiler
The utility model relates to a kind of coal-fired smoke elimination vertical boiler, belongs to a kind of vertical boiler.
Existing coal-fired vertical boiler, the overwhelming majority is following to wind for fire grate, this boiler combustion is insufficient, and efficient is low, and the flue gas dust concentration height of discharging from chimney, do not reach national requirements for environmental protection, indivedual also have in burner hearth, be provided with air outlet, though thisly help burning of coal, it is more abundant to burn, but this wind of giving can not form air curtain, still has volume of smoke to discharge from chimney.
The purpose of this utility model be to overcome the weak point in the background technology and provide a kind of smoke medicining dust-removing effect good, make the fire coal smoke elimination vertical boiler that coal combustion is abundant, energy-conservation, rational in infrastructure, be convenient to keep in repair.
The purpose of this utility model is achieved in that it comprises body of heater, water inlet pipe, outlet pipe, fire door, burner hearth, fire grate, shoot door, bellows, chimney etc., the middle fire bars of its fire grate is that straight line parallel is arranged, fire bars is that concentric circles is arranged on every side, establishes 2~5 layers of wind apparatus of giving of giving wind in the burner hearth; Roof of the furnace is provided with heat-storing device; The fire bars below that straight line parallel is arranged is provided with a columnar choke device.
The purpose of this utility model can also realize by following technical measures: chewed for wind apparatus by ajutage and wind and form, ajutage is communicated with chamber on the bellows by the wind pushing hole of chamber on the bellows, the wind on the same horizontal line chew into one deck to wind.Heat-storing device is a hemispherical, is fixed on the dividing plate, and bellows are the live body bellows, places on the body of heater of fire grate below, and bellows are disc, and the centre has dividing plate to be divided into upper and lower two Room, and top, last chamber is provided with wind pushing hole, and following chamber interior walls is provided with wind and chews.
The utility model compared with prior art has following advantage:
1, compact conformation is reasonable;
2, because the middle fire bars of fire grate employing is that straight line parallel is arranged, fire bars is that concentric circles is arranged on every side, the two is in conjunction with constituting fire grate, and below part arranged in a straight line, be provided with the cylindrical shape choke device, concentric circles fire grate part is corresponding with the air blast direction, thereby increased air output under the fire grate, top coal is fully burnt, form the combustion high temperature district, and the straight line parallel aligning part makes coal on this part fire grate at high temperature by destructive distillation because air-supply is insufficient, the completing combustion under the air curtain effect of the fuel gas of generation, thereby coal combustion is abundant, economizes on coal;
3, owing to establish 2~5 layers of wind apparatus of giving of giving wind in the burner hearth, the multilayer ajutage promptly is set around the inner bag of combustion zone, the wind of a plurality of ajutages is chewed simultaneously to the boiler air blast during burning, form the multilayer air curtain, the flue gas that coal combustion on the fire grate produces is trapped in the burner hearth under the stopping of air curtain, under the condition of high temperature oxygenation, burn away, flue gas is through the effect repeatedly of multilayer air curtain, final realization completing combustion, pure hot gas breaks through air curtain and enters the heat convection district and carry out heat exchange, thereby having improved the thermal efficiency, smoke medicining dust-removing effect is good, meets national requirements for environmental protection fully;
4, because roof of the furnace is provided with heat-storing device in order to regulate fire box temperature, when in the burner hearth during coal-fired normal combustion, the fire box temperature height, the heat-storing device storage of absorbing heat, when fire box temperature is reduced, heat-storing device carries out heat release improving fire box temperature, thereby has realized burner hearth to be rapidly heated and burn.
